How to Foot Massage at Home

A foot massage can be an incredibly relaxing experience, but it can also provide relief for a variety of foot-related issues, such as plantar fasciitis, neuropathy, and arthritis. Here are the steps to follow to give yourself a foot massage at home:

Step 1: Set the Mood

Before you begin, make sure you are in a comfortable and relaxing environment. Dim the lights, light a few candles, and put on some calming music. You may also want to soak your feet in warm water for 10-15 minutes to help loosen up your muscles and prepare your feet for the massage.

Step 2: Apply Massage Oil

Apply a small amount of massage oil or lotion to your hands and rub them together to warm the oil up. You can use any type of oil that you prefer, such as coconut oil, olive oil, or jojoba oil.

Step 3: Work on the Soles of Your Feet

Start by placing your thumbs on the soles of your feet and applying pressure in a circular motion. Use your fingers to massage the arch of your foot, working your way from the heel to the toes. Pay special attention to any areas that feel particularly sore or tight.

Step 4: Massage Your Toes

Gently massage each of your toes, starting at the base and working your way up to the tip. Use your fingers to gently pull and stretch each toe, being careful not to apply too much pressure.

Step 5: Finish with Ankle Massage

Finish your foot massage by working on your ankles. Use your thumbs to apply pressure in circular motions around your ankle bones. You can also use your fingers to gently massage the sides and back of your ankles.

Tips for a Better Foot Massage

Follow these tips to get the most out of your foot massage:

  • Use a comfortable chair or couch to sit on.
  • Use a foot roller or tennis ball to massage the soles of your feet.
  • Don't apply too much pressure - a foot massage should be relaxing, not painful.
  • Take your time and enjoy the experience.

Solutions for Common Foot Massage Issues

If you experience any discomfort or pain during your foot massage, try these solutions:

  • Apply less pressure to the affected area.
  • Take a break and stretch your feet and toes.
  • Massage the area around the affected area instead of directly on it.
  • If the pain persists, consult a healthcare professional.
